Respuestas:
NetHogs es probablemente lo que estás buscando:
Una pequeña herramienta 'net top'. En lugar de desglosar el tráfico por protocolo o subred, como la mayoría de las herramientas, agrupa el ancho de banda por proceso .
NetHogs no se basa en un módulo especial del núcleo para cargarse. Si de repente hay mucho tráfico de red, puede activar NetHogs e inmediatamente ver qué PID está causando esto. Esto facilita la identificación de programas que se han vuelto locos y de repente están ocupando su ancho de banda.
Como NetHogs depende en gran medida de / proc, la mayoría de las funciones solo están disponibles en Linux. NetHogs se puede construir en Mac OS X y FreeBSD, pero solo mostrará conexiones, no procesos ...
nethogs
es agradable, pero parece que el uso manera más CPU en mi equipo queiftop
-t
, -c
y analizar con grep / SED.
También iftop :
mostrar el uso de ancho de banda en una interfaz
iftop hace para uso de red lo que top (1) hace para uso de CPU. Escucha el tráfico de red en una interfaz con nombre y muestra una tabla de uso de ancho de banda actual por pares de hosts. Útil para responder la pregunta "¿por qué nuestro enlace ADSL es tan lento?" ...
iptraf es mi favorito Tiene una agradable interfaz ncurses y opciones para filtrar, etc.
Otra opción que puedes probar es iptstate .